Question
There are three numbers. If the average of any two of
them is added to the third number, the sums obtained are 177, 163 and 138. Whatis the average of the largest and the smallest of the given numbers?Solution
Let the three numbers be x, y, z. X+y / 2 + z = 177 x + y + 2z = 354 …(1) Y + z / 2 + X = 163 2x + y + z = 326 …(2) x + z / 2 + y = 138 x + 2y + z = 276 …(3) Adding eq(1),(2),(3) and dividing it by 4, we get x + y + z = 239 ,,,(4) sub (1) - (4), z = 115 sub (2) - (4), x = 87 sub (3) - (4), y = 37 The average of largest and smallest = 115+37/2 = 76
